Elements of a Well-Crafted Blessing

A well-crafted blessing for a flower basket at a cork opening should include several key elements:

  • Gratitude: Express thanks for the bountiful harvest, the craftsmanship, and the heritage of the winery.
  • Wishes for Success: Extend good wishes for the success of the new vintage, hoping it will be enjoyed by many and praised for its quality.
  • Reflection on the Journey: Reflect on the journey of the grapes from vine to bottle, honoring the process and the people involved.
  • Poetic Language: Use poetic and elegant language to match the sophistication of the occasion.

Sample Blessing for a Flower Basket

Here’s a sample blessing that you can adapt to your needs:

"Blessings upon this bountiful harvest, a tribute to the earth's rich soil and the sun's warm embrace. May this wine, born from the careful tending of vine and vinedresser, be a symphony of flavors, a testament to the art of winemaking. As we celebrate the opening of this cork, let us raise a toast to the future, where this vintage will be savored and shared, carrying with it the essence of this special place and the spirit of those who crafted it. With gratitude for the past, and hope for the future, we present this basket of blooms, a fragrant promise of joy to come."

Tips for Writing Your Own Blessing

When writing your own blessing, consider the following tips:

  • Keep it Brief: A blessing should be concise yet impactful.
  • Personalize It: Incorporate details about the winery or the specific wine to make the blessing more meaningful.
  • Practice Proper Etiquette: Ensure your language is appropriate for the formal nature of the event.
  • Seek Inspiration: Look to poetry, literature, or historical blessings for inspiration on phrasing and structure.
